About The Position

Must hold a Dental Radiographer Certificate The dental assistant is proficient at assisting in the examination and treatment of dental oncology patients under the direction of the dentist. Responsible for assisting the dentist in the examination of patients including obtaining dental imaging, conducts patient interviews, measures vital signs (i.e. pulse rate, temperature, blood pressure, weight, and height), and records patient information accurately and appropriately in EMR and/or patient‘s charts.
